700 S Flower St #2925, Los Angeles, California 90017
(855) 662-2772
Our goal is to help immigrants obtain legal status in the United States by offering a unique and well thought-out immigration relief plan. We do this by providing the best legal strategies, presenting great quality work, and by building a long-lasting rel